Red Flags to Watch Out For

Alright, let's talk about red flags. These are the warning signs that should make you pause and think twice before trusting any app, including iSweet Bonanza. If you spot any of these, proceed with extreme caution!

  • Unrealistic Promises: This is the BIGGEST red flag. Does the app promise incredibly high payouts for minimal effort? If it sounds too good to be true, it almost certainly is. Legitimate money-making opportunities require real work and effort. No app is going to make you rich overnight, especially by just watching a few videos.
  • Pushy Tactics: Watch out for apps that use aggressive or manipulative tactics to get you to sign up or spend money. This could include constant notifications, scare tactics, or pressure to refer friends. Legitimate platforms don't need to resort to such tactics.
  • Lack of Transparency: A trustworthy app will be upfront about how it works, how you earn money, and its terms and conditions. If the app is vague, hides information, or uses complicated jargon, that's a major red flag. You should be able to easily understand how the app operates and what you're getting into.
  • Hidden Fees: Does the app require you to pay a fee to withdraw your earnings or access certain features? Be wary of apps that try to nickel and dime you with hidden fees. Legitimate platforms typically don't charge you to access your own money.
  • Poor Reviews: Always check the app's reviews on the app store and other websites. Are there a lot of negative reviews mentioning problems with payouts, customer service, or the app's overall functionality? While a few bad reviews are normal, a consistent pattern of negative feedback is a major warning sign.
  • Permissions: Pay attention to the permissions the app requests when you install it. Does it ask for access to your contacts, camera, or other sensitive information that it doesn't need? Be cautious about granting unnecessary permissions, as this could be a sign that the app is trying to collect your personal data.
  • No Contact Information: A legitimate company will provide clear and accessible contact information, such as an email address or phone number. If the app doesn't offer any way to contact the developers, that's a red flag.
  • Suspicious Website: Even if the app seems legitimate, take a look at the developer's website. Does it look professional and trustworthy? Is the domain registered recently? A poorly designed or recently created website can be a sign of a scam.

By being aware of these red flags, you can significantly reduce your risk of falling victim to a scam app like iSweet Bonanza. Always trust your gut and err on the side of caution if something feels off.

Safety Tips to Avoid Scam Apps

So, how do you protect yourself from scam apps like iSweet Bonanza? Here are some essential safety tips to keep in mind:

  1. Do Your Research: Before downloading any app that promises to make you money, take the time to research the developer and read user reviews. Look for patterns of complaints and be wary of apps with overly positive or generic reviews. Check for the developer's contact information and make sure they have a legitimate website. A little research can go a long way in preventing scams.
  2. Be Skeptical of Unrealistic Promises: If an app promises incredibly high payouts for minimal effort, it's probably a scam. Legitimate money-making opportunities require real work and effort. Don't fall for the get-rich-quick schemes. If it sounds too good to be true, it almost certainly is!
  3. Protect Your Personal Information: Be cautious about sharing your personal information with apps, especially your financial details. Avoid apps that ask for unnecessary permissions or collect excessive data. Only provide the information that is absolutely necessary to use the app.
  4. Use Strong Passwords: Use strong, unique passwords for all of your online accounts, including your app store account. Avoid using the same password for multiple accounts. A strong password can help protect your account from being hacked..
  5. Keep Your Software Up to Date: Make sure your device's operating system and apps are up to date. Software updates often include security patches that can protect you from malware and other threats. Regular updates are crucial for maintaining your device's security.
  6. Use a Security App: Consider installing a security app on your device to help protect you from malware and phishing attacks. These apps can scan your device for threats and warn you about suspicious websites and apps. A security app can provide an extra layer of protection against scams.
  7. Report Suspicious Apps: If you encounter a scam app, report it to the app store and the Federal Trade Commission (FTC). This can help warn other users and prevent the app from scamming more people. Reporting scams is important for protecting yourself and others.
  8. Trust Your Gut: If something feels off about an app, trust your gut and avoid using it. It's better to be safe than sorry. If you have a bad feeling, don't ignore it!

By following these safety tips, you can significantly reduce your risk of falling victim to scam apps and protect your personal information. Always remember to be cautious and do your research before downloading any app that promises to make you money.

Alternatives to iSweet Bonanza

Okay, so maybe iSweet Bonanza isn't looking so hot after all. But don't worry, there are actually some legitimate ways to earn a little extra cash online. They might not make you rich overnight, but they're safer and more reliable than questionable apps. Here are a few alternatives to consider:

  • Freelance Platforms: Websites like Upwork, Fiverr, and Guru connect freelancers with clients who need help with various tasks, such as writing, graphic design, web development, and more. If you have skills in any of these areas, you can find paying gigs on these platforms.
  • Online Surveys: Companies like Swagbucks, Survey Junkie, and MyPoints pay you for sharing your opinion. While you won't earn a lot of money, it's an easy way to make a few extra dollars in your spare time.
  • Microtask Websites: Amazon Mechanical Turk (MTurk) is a platform where you can complete small tasks, such as data entry, image tagging, and transcription, for a small fee.
  • Delivery Services: Companies like DoorDash, Uber Eats, and Instacart allow you to earn money by delivering food or groceries to customers. This can be a good option if you have a car and some free time.
  • Online Tutoring: If you're knowledgeable in a particular subject, you can offer your services as an online tutor. Websites like Chegg Tutors and TutorMe connect tutors with students who need help with their studies.
  • Affiliate Marketing: If you have a website or blog, you can earn money by promoting other companies' products. When someone clicks on your affiliate link and makes a purchase, you earn a commission.

Remember, these alternatives require real effort and time. You're not going to get rich quick, but you can earn a decent income if you're willing to put in the work. Always research any platform before signing up and be wary of scams. Look for established companies with good reputations and transparent terms and conditions.
